Sale!
4.8/5
295 reviews
Sale!
4.8/5
285 reviews
Sale!
4.8/5
188 reviews
Sale!
4.8/5
194 reviews
Sale!
4.8/5
84 reviews
Sale!
4.8/5
263 reviews
Sale!
4.8/5
102 reviews
Sale!
4.8/5
282 reviews
Sale!
4.8/5
241 reviews
Sale!
4.8/5
134 reviews
Sale!
4.8/5
146 reviews
Sale!
4.8/5
192 reviews
Sale!
4.8/5
254 reviews
Sale!
4.8/5
188 reviews
Sale!
4.8/5
114 reviews
Sale!
4.8/5
111 reviews
Sale!
4.8/5
228 reviews
Sale!
4.8/5
167 reviews
Sale!
4.8/5
150 reviews
Sale!
4.8/5
119 reviews
Sale!
4.8/5
97 reviews
